SUATE-ORELLANA v. BARR

No. 19-60729.

979 F.3d 1056 (2020)

Ninonska SUATE-ORELLANA, also known as Ninoska Suate-Orellana, Petitioner, v. William P. BARR, U.S. Attorney General, Respondent.

United States Court of Appeals, Fifth Circuit.

Filed November 3, 2020.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Naomi Sunshine , Washington Square Legal Services, Immigrant Rights Clinic, New York, NY, for Petitioner.

Kathryn M. McKinney , Arthur Rabin , Trial Attorney, U.S. Department of Justice, Office of Immigration Litigation, Washington, DC, for Respondent.

Before Jones, Haynes, and Ho, Circuit Judges.


Petitioner Ninoska Suate-Orellana asks this court to reverse an unfavorable decision from the Board of Immigration Appeals (the "Board" or "BIA"). Specifically, she appeals the Board's (1) adverse credibility determination, (2) decision to deny withholding of removal relief, (3) denial of her claim under the Convention...
